Job Description

TPIS is seeking an IT Help Desk professional to provide technical assistance, system support, and information management within the systems department for a financial services client. This onsite role is based in Trujillo Alto Municipio, Puerto Rico.

Responsibilities

  • Deliver technical support to end users and the organization’s information systems.
  • Monitor networks, servers, and inter-branch communications.
  • Diagnose system issues and track incident resolution.
  • Create regular reports on a daily, monthly, quarterly, and annual cadence.
  • Administer user access rights to systems and applications.
  • Execute data backups and safeguard data custody.
  • Transmit files to external agencies and service providers.
  • Assist in implementing policies, procedures, and technology upgrades.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or Information Systems.
  • At least two years of experience in similar IT roles, preferably within financial institutions or cooperatives.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office, Outlook, Teams, Zoom, and information systems.
  • Bilingual abilities are preferred, particularly Spanish and English.
  • Strong analytical abilities, meticulous attention to detail, and solid probl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work under supervision and manage multiple tasks concurrently.
